A 17-year-old is in custody, charged with aggravated child abuse and chemical endangerment after police were notified of a 4-year-old with signs of physical abuse and who tested positive for drugs.
Mobile police said officers were dispatched to USA Children and Women’s Hospital about 9 p.m. on a report of a “severely injured” child with multiple injuries and extensive bruising. Police did not specify which drug was found in the child’s system. Monday afternoon, investigators identified the primary suspect -- a 17-year-old male who frequently serves as a babysitter for the child’s mother. He was located and taken into custody, later transported to Mobile Metro Jail. His identity has not been released because he is a minor.In addition, the Alabama Department of Human Resources is working with investigators to determine the full set of circumstances surrounding the incident and to ensure the child’s well-being, according to police.
